Transaction 875028ea760d6ed2860cd39afd76d308db5465131a3a36d0507ef58e00d6d304

1 Input
2 Outputs
  • 875028ea760d6ed2860cd39afd76d308db5465131a3a36d0507ef58e00d6d304:0
  • value  10645000
    address  32PmL4ojp9q5KQh21NbcGtWvmVPKwYTacx
  • 875028ea760d6ed2860cd39afd76d308db5465131a3a36d0507ef58e00d6d304:1
  • value  569680551
    address  bc1q2hrvx2eq4a5t2wp2w886hzef59jw2ajeknhhax